Best Schools in Walsh, WI
Walsh, WI has a total of 9 schools including 3 high schools, 3 middle schools and 3 elementary schools. A total of 2,251 students attend Walsh, WI schools. On average, schools in Walsh score 23%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 31%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Walsh underperform exp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Walsh, WI
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Walsh, WI has a total population of 624 with 19%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 94%, and 20%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
